Why...?.

Ingredients:
Ground soybean hulls, ground corn, ground oats, dehulled soybean meal, wheat middlings, cane molasses, brewers dried yeast, soybean oil, wheat germ, dehydrated alfalfa meal, dicalcium phosphate, calcium carbonate, salt, DL-methionine, choline chloride, menadione dimethylpyrimidinol bisulfite (source of vitamin K), pyridoxine hydrochloride, d-alpha tocopheryl acetate (natural source vitamin E), cholecalciferol (vitamin D3), biotin, calcium pantothenate, ethoxyquin (a preservative), vitamin A acetate, riboflavin, folic acid, nicotinic acid, thiamin mononitrate, cyanocobalamin (vitamin B12), manganous oxide, zinc oxide, ferrous carbonate, copper sulfate, zinc sulfate, calcium iodate, cobalt carbonate, sodium selenite.

This:

Nutrazu® Tortoise Diet has been designed for Galapagos tortoises, but may be useful for other species of dry land tortoises. Feed approximately 2-4% of body weight. It is not necessary to add water. Feed consumption will vary with temperature. Feed with good quality grass hay. Fresh fruits and vegetables (less than 20% by weight of total diet) may also be provided if desired.

My tortoises do not come from the Galapagos and nor do many others that people keep. Where I live has no resemblance to the Galapagos. I don't feed my tortoises grass hay, fresh fruit or vegetables.

As for the ingredients - a lot of those are in animal feeds, but farm animals. They are for quick, accelerated growth and bulking up (for obvious reasons). Some of the other ingredients are known to cause kidney and liver failure.

Soybean (soya bean), corn, oats, wheat middlings and dried brewers yeast, cane molluscs and salt - for tortoises?

That is just the first few listed.
